I wonder if anyone else has found this issue when using the rift with the sabre?

 

I have checked my camera bounds and I am well within them. The flight starts ok, and everything is stable. Then after some maneuvering, the entire cockpit model starts to jiggle. Its a little bit like when TrackIR spazzes out when you get too close to the geometry, except I'm perfectly centred in the middle of the cockpit and camera range.

 

Looking around a bit or recentering with Num Pad 5 makes it stop for a brief moment, but then it returns. As a comparison to see if its my Rift, I am not having the issue with the warthog so it seems to be something to do with the sabre model.

 

Anyone else found this?

Hehe talking to myself but in case anyone else comes looking with the same issue:

 

It seems that DCS is fussier with camera bounds than other VR apps, and I experimented with putting the camera up higher and further back, with the lens aimed at my chest. Its now about 2 feet above me and about 5 feet away.

 

This seems to have cleared up pretty much all of the jiggle - black shark is rock solid, Huey too. Only the Sabre seems to have the occasional twitch, usually at the end of a head movement COMBINED with maneuvering. Its as though the game is having trouble resolving all the movement and momentarily goes into a spasm.

 

Frame rate seems fine at the time so to me this is more a camera bounds problem. Letting it 'see' more seems to be the answer.
